What Is a Portable Luggage Scale and Why Is It Essential for Travelers?

A portable luggage scale is a compact and lightweight device designed to measure the weight of luggage before traveling. It typically consists of a handheld unit with a hook at one end to attach to the luggage handle. Travelers can lift the luggage by the handle, and the scale will display the weight on a digital or analog readout.

How Important Is Scale Accuracy When Weighing Luggage?

Scale accuracy is very important when weighing luggage. Accurate scales help travelers avoid overweight baggage fees. Airlines often impose strict weight limits on luggage. If the scale is not accurate, travelers may misjudge their luggage weight. This can lead to surprises at the check-in counter.

Accurate scales provide reliable measurements. A difference of even a few ounces can impact baggage fees. Travelers should prioritize finding a scale that offers precision. Many portable luggage scales claim high accuracy and can weigh items up to several pounds. Look for features that indicate accuracy, such as digital displays or calibration options.

Calibration ensures that the scale provides correct readings over time. Users should check the scale’s accuracy by verifying it against known weights. This practice helps maintain the integrity of measurements.

In summary, scale accuracy is crucial for successful travel. It ensures that travelers do not incur unexpected charges and can easily manage their luggage. An accurate scale supports better planning and stress-free travel experiences.
